Kernel panic via premature legacy driver removal
Published May 9, 2025 · Updated May 11, 2026
Denial of service in the Linux fsl-qspi driver allows local users to panic the kernel by unbinding an i.MX8MQ SPI device. The driver mixes device-managed APIs with a legacy remove callback, so detach invokes manual removal before device-managed cleanup and violates the release sequence. Access to the privileged sysfs driver-unbind control on a system with the fsl-quadspi device is required; detaching it crashes the host.
